2014 Wedding Series: Wedding Cake First Class Postage Stamps
The 2014 Wedding Cake stamp covered the two-ounce rate, a postage category often required for wedding invitations, save-the-date cards, and other oversized correspondence. This elegant issue followed the first Wedding Cake stamp released in 2009.
While catering often accounts for a significant portion of wedding expenses, the wedding cake — despite being a highlight of the celebration — typically represents a relatively small part of the budget. On average, the cake, topper, and cutting fees often total under $600, with the per-slice cost comparable to that of a restaurant dessert. However, intricate recipes, premium ingredients, and elaborate designs can quickly elevate even a modest budget.
Regardless of cost, the wedding cake remains a beloved tradition — a symbolic centerpiece of one of life’s most meaningful celebrations.
The beautiful cake featured on this stamp was created and designed by pastry chef Peter Brett and photographed by Renée Comet, perfectly capturing the elegance and joy of a couple’s special day.
